Duty-free cars purchased in Hainan cannot be driven back to the mainland. If driven out of Hainan Island, the taxes must be paid. Below is relevant information about duty-free cars: Introduction: Duty-free cars refer to specific tax-exempt vehicles introduced by the state to encourage overseas students to return and serve the country, offering special tax exemption benefits for overseas returnees purchasing domestically produced cars. Scope of duty-free cars: The benefits include exemption from tariffs on major imported components of domestic cars and a 10% vehicle purchase tax on the total vehicle price.
